
h2.sitetitle {font-size: 2.2em; padding-top: 10px; }
.subhead {font-size: .6em; }
.motto {color: #DDEEFF; }

h1.maintitle {color: #003399; font-family: Arial Rounded MT Bold, Arial; font-size: 3.8em; margin: 0px; }
.byline {margin-top: -12px; }
.section {color: #9900FF; font-weight: bold; }

h3.heading {color: blue; font-size: 1.3em; font-family: Arial, sans-serif; padding-top: 15px; border-bottom: 1px solid blue; }
h4.heading {color: #990066; font-size: 1em; padding-top: 15px; padding-bottom: 3px; padding-left: 5px; border-bottom: 1px solid #990066; width: 80%; }

input {font-family: arial, helvetica, sans-serif; font-size: 10pt; }
input.searchbox {border: black 2px solid; width: 150px; height: 25px; }
input.button {background-color: #9999cc; color: white;  font-weight: bold; height: 25px; }

code {font-family: verdana, courier, monospace; color: #0033aa; font-size: .9em; }

.navbox {background-color: #EFEFFF; border: 3px solid white; padding: 5px; font-size: .9em; font-weight: bold; }
.navlink {background-color: #EFEFFF; border: 2px solid white; padding: 2px; }

hr.big {color: #0033CC; height: 4px; text-align: center; margin: -10px; }
hr.blue {color: #0033CC; height: 3px; text-align: center; }
hr.white {color: white; height: 1px; width: 90%; margin-bottom: -5px; }

.indent {padding: 5px; padding-left: 20px; text-align: left; border: 3px solid white; }

.sourcetip {background-color: #9999cc; color: white; padding: 5px; border: thin dotted white; font-size: .9em; }
.tiptag {color: #e0e0ff; }

.symbol {font-family: Wingdings; font-size: 1.4em; color: #000099; }
.js {color: #cc0000; }
.css {color: green; }
.ie {color: #0066ff; font-weight: bold; }
.nn {color: #006699; font-weight: bold; }
.value {color: #0033cc; font-size: .8em; }
.html4 {color: #0099cc; }
.old {color: #666699; }

.important {border: #33CC00 2px solid; padding: 10px; padding-left: 20px; margin-top: -20px; }
.vimportant {color: green; font-weight: bold; margin-bottom: 10px; }

.pagefeedback {background-color:#66CC00; border-top: 5px solid #99FF00; padding: 5px; }

.boxhead {color: #CCCCFF; }
.moreresources {font-size: .9em; font-weight: normal; }
